Summary: Support default write mode, settable via spark config
Key: SPARK-23061
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-23061
Project: Spark
Issue Type: Brainstorming
Components: ML, MLlib, SQL
Affects Versions: 2.1.0
Reporter: Stephan Sahm
Priority: Minor
Especially when using libraries which internally use sparkdataframe.write, but also in general it would be helpful to be able to overwrite the default writing mode from "error" to for instance "overwrite" via a new spark config value
